The use of categories is that you can let DIM do the installations, then go to "Content directory", look for all the "New" marked content, and categorize that to your liking. That way, I get my textures (or any texture add on I might buy later), for a product in the same "category folder" with my product, or sort all my room sets into my sub-category "rooms", etc. It's pretty nifty, because I can easily move stuff around, and even duplicate a category with its content if I feel like it. For example, I have the Iray shaders categorized under Shaders, but I also have an Iray category where I categorized them. Which vategory I use depends on my workflow.
Now... categorizing from Smart content into my Category listing, this might turn into a challenge. I haven't really have the time to tet much, but I'll see how it fares with some newly installed content.
Basically, Categorizing is kind of like moving around your content files into different directories, just that it doesn't touch the files. And of course, the mess in the original file structure remains, and it's still difficult to find a file if you access your stuff from elewhere, or if you want to add part of a different skin to a character, and have to look up the actual file for the diffuse map.

That works. You can also use the categorize pane to create new categories. And you can drag and drop one or more items into various categories.
Example 1:
When you drag and drop to categorize, if you a product in the scene selected, the drag and drop will also remember that the item is associated with that product.
Example 2:
Thanks to drag and drop, organization of your content, the way you want to organize it, is a snap.
And to make sure your changes are kept through rebuilding of your database, it is a good idea to "Export userdata" after you make changes. This is found under content database maintenance.
